Actually, most fund managers will say that they are using value-investing method to some extent or the other. Nobody is going to say that they are buying stocks at valuations that they think are too high.
So, at the end of the day, you have to just go with a quality manager and trust him/her. As Ramesh points out above, good multi-cap and small-mid cap funds are your best bets.
I would add HDFC Mid cap opportunities and IDFC Premier equity fund to the list, as well as ICICI Pru Dynamic fund. Please note that IDFC PEF is available only for SIP investments.

Templeton India Growth fund and Templeton India Equity Income fund are large-cap oriented multicap value funds.
ICICI Discovery and Templeton Smaller companies are small-mid cap oriented value funds.
Sundaram Taxsaver is a value-growth (=blended) taxsaver fund.
